Don C’s Jordan Legacy 312 Brings Back Iconic Colorways
Don C has always been a close associate to Jordan Brand and now, Jordan Brand is giving him his own silhouette known as the Jordan Legacy 312. The Jordan Legacy 312 is a combination of three silhouettes which is the Air Jordan 1, Air Jordan 3 and the Nike Alpha Force Low. Jordan Brand continues… Read more »

Do We Hear Nuggets? Jordan Brand Is Re-Releasing The Air Jordan 2 ‘Melo’ In The Denver Nuggets Colorway
If you watched NBA back in the days, Carmelo Anthony wore the Air Jordan 2 in the Denver Nuggets colorway on the court which was originally a PE (player exclusive). It was then released in April 2004 and for fans trying to catch up with Melo’s sneakers in current times, their chance has come. This release… Read more »
